Ketones and Aldehydes
... Acetals will hydrolyze under acidic conditions, but are stable to strong bases and nucleophiles. They are also easily formed from aldehydes and ketones, and also easily converted back to the parent carbonyl compounds. These characteristics make acetals ideal protecting groups for aldehydes and keton ...
